WebJan 17, 2024 · As little as one alcoholic beverage in a 24-hour period can cause a gout flare, and the risk increases the more drinks you have daily. 1. Gout (also called gouty arthritis) is caused by hyperuricemia , a condition marked by an excess amount of uric acid in the blood. 2 Alcohol can increase uric acid levels in the body, resulting in gout flares.
